Sinus is a common infection and thousands of people suffer it every day without knowing about actual sinus infection symptoms. Sinus attacks are generally caused with infection caused in sinuses, which is present in the bones surrounding nasal cavity. Whenever there are any sinus infection symptoms, there are many discomforts and other indications observed and condition is known as sinusitis.

There are mainly four locations sinuses, including Frontal Sinuses (Forehead), Maxillary Sinuses (back of cheek bones), Sphenoid Sinuses (Rear of eyes) and Ethmoid Sinuses (In between eyes). It is crucial to check sinus infection symptoms and find out the location of infection. Each sinus has an opening in the skull, which allows exchange of air and mucus inside the cavity.
Sinuses are joined through a membrane made up of mucous. In case of any infection entering into body, this membrane and cavity gets inflamed. This creates blockage of mucus or a vacuum is created inside the area. It causes severe pain and gives sinus infection symptoms to the body of an individual.

Know about some common Sinus Infection Symptoms



  • Sinus discharge of greenish yellow in color can be observed coming out from nasal cavity and includes blood in severe cases. It might drain off from your nose or back of your throat area.
  • Pain in your forehead, eyes or head can be one of the most common sinus infection symptoms.
  • Sinus creates a fatigued feeling and patient might feel sick without even having much physical exertion. This is one of the most unnoticed sinus infection symptoms and people usually ignore it as they feel that their body might get rest or is routinely sick.
  • Blockage in sinus or nose passage is also a common symptom. People having sinus infection usually sleep with their mouth opened at night as it becomes stressful to inhale air through nose.
  • Sinus infection can lead to a poor sensing of tasting or smelling for a person. This is due to clogged mucous in nasal cavity.
  • Sinus drainage is infectious and swallowing it through throat area can upset digestion and make you feel nauseated often.
  • Sinus infections might result in a regular sore throat problem and bad breath. This is only due to infected drainage from mucus or cavity.
  • Sinus patients usually get fever and sickness very soon.
Sinus infection symptoms vary according to the effected sinus area or cavity. Frontal sinuses mainly have painful experiences over eyes, forehead and brow area; maxillary sinus have infection inside cheek area, mouth and throat; ethmoid and sphenoid sinuses have most effect on eyes and nasal cavity. The pain caused by sinus has different behavior and effects on variable cases. Sinusitis is commonly diagnosed by tapping sinus area with fingertips. In rare cases, acute sinusitis can even infect brain or nervous system.
